About this game
Agent Hugo: RoboRumble is a fast paced racing game with platform elements.
The city of Aquapolis has been invaded by a new evil villain - Geekdorph, Lord of Robots.

Agent Hugo escapes to a teleporter and gets beamed to the secret hideout of R.I.S.K (Risky Intelligent Spy Knights).
From the hideout, Hugo must teleport into space, the desert and Aquapolis to defeat Geekdorph's challenges and collect information about Geekdorph's secret location - so the final three stage boss-fight can take place and the citizens of Aquapolis set free.
Hugo has a companion - TEX 2000 - an intelligent hoverboard.
Destroy robots with his force field or shoot them with lasers, missiles and smart bombs! Accelerate TEX 2000 to extreme speeds and take risky jumps to increase your score.
The player controls Hugo standing on the hoverboard (TEX 2000) and has to help him complete three main game plays in a total of nine levels. "Time run": Can you complete a number of rounds on time? "Destroy all robots": Can you takeout all robots? "Point collect": Jump high - look around! - can you make a perfect score?
About PlayStation 2
The PlayStation 2 (2000) is the best-selling game console in history, with a library exceeding 9,000 titles that spans everything from budget shovelware to genre-defining classics. That massive volume means PS2 collecting is accessible and affordable overall, but a handful of low-print-run RPGs and cult titles have become genuinely expensive — a common pattern once a console's original audience grows up with disposable income.
